If there's an issue at all, it'll show up in 300 miles, no matter how hard the car is driven.

Indy's will be getting a new post- procedure checklist soon, and all Certified Installers will be required to carry this out. All Preferred Installers will have it added to their Code Of Conduct, as well.

The main thing is ensuring the shop carried out a pre- qualification procedure on the rest of the engine first. Its the other things that are unknown, if assumed "good", that will take out the retrofit bearing.
